What You Should Know

Progresso Soup, Vegetable Classics Macaroni & Bean (19 oz) sits in the canned soup aisle, stacked alongside other ready-to-heat options like condensed and ready-to-serve soups, broths, and canned vegetables. You’ll spot it near familiar competitors such as Campbell’s and private-label soup lines, and often on endcaps during promotions. It is aimed at busy households and single adults who want a quick, inexpensive hot meal—positioned as a convenient, home-style comfort option rather than gourmet fare. The brand leans on an approachable, all-American identity: reliable, family-friendly, and slightly nostalgic for boxed-lunch or school-lunch memories. The label leans into simple cues — “Vegetarian Ingredients” and imagery of beans and pasta — that give a mild health halo without organic or non-GMO certification. Packaging is a 19 oz metal can (shelf-stable, recyclable) with bright photography and the Progresso logo; preparation ritual is simple heating on a stove or microwave and serving with bread or crackers. Sensory notes: a tomato-forward broth with soft Great Northern beans, small Rigati macaroni that soaks up broth, a slightly thickened mouthfeel from added starch, and a savory, salty finish from stock, yeast extract, and cheese. In plain terms, this is a processed, shelf-stable canned soup made with some added stabilizers and flavor enhancers; it’s crafted for speed and consistency rather than from-scratch freshness. Typical uses include quick lunches, an easy weeknight dinner accompaniment, or as part of a storm-prep pantry.

Ultra-Processing Assessment

NOVA Score:4 / 4

Ultra-Processed

Why this score?

Contains industrial ingredients and additives such as modified food starch, hydrolyzed corn protein, yeast extract and natural flavors and is a shelf-stable canned product, consistent with NOVA group 4 (ultraprocessed).
